NEO Battery signs LOI with Japan drone maker Liberaware on high-performance battery manufacturing
  • NEO Battery signed a three-year, non-binding LOI with Japan drone maker Liberaware, including subsidiary Hinotate, to co-develop high-performance drone batteries.
  • Parties will assess a Japan-based cell and pack assembly facility, including testing and quality control, with a potential JV or SPV structure.
  • Work includes evaluating NEO’s electrode and battery manufacturing capabilities in South Korea to support a Japan production footprint.
  • Collaboration targets longer flight time, range, payload, reliability through integrated cell, pack, BMS, airframe optimization for GPS-denied environments.
  • Deal aims to support Japan’s sovereign drone supply chain, with Liberaware supplying major Japanese infrastructure operators including East Japan Railway.
